The percentage of the total volume of rock or sediment that consists of spaces between particles is called porosity. It is a crucial property in fields such as geology and hydrogeology, as it affects the storage and movement of fluids within the rock or sediment. Porosity is typically expressed as a percentage, indicating the ratio of void spaces to the total volume of the material.

The spaces between rocks and soil are called pore spaces or interstitial spaces. These spaces are important for water infiltration, aeration, and root penetration in the soil.

The spaces between cells are called intercellular spaces. These spaces allow for the exchange of gases, nutrients, and waste products between cells. They also provide flexibility and allow for movement within tissues.
